4 # Make command line options:
5 #       -DNO_CLEANDIR run ${MAKE} clean, instead of ${MAKE} cleandir
6 #       -DNO_CLEAN do not clean at all
7 #       -DDB_FROM_SRC use the user/group databases in src/etc instead of
8 #           the system database when installing.
9 #       -DNO_SHARE do not go into share subdir
10 #       -DKERNFAST define NO_KERNEL{CONFIG,CLEAN,DEPEND,OBJ}
11 #       -DNO_KERNELCONFIG do not run config in ${MAKE} buildkernel
12 #       -DNO_KERNELCLEAN do not run ${MAKE} clean in ${MAKE} buildkernel
13 #       -DNO_KERNELDEPEND do not run ${MAKE} depend in ${MAKE} buildkernel
14 #       -DNO_KERNELOBJ do not run ${MAKE} obj in ${MAKE} buildkernel
15 #       -DNO_PORTSUPDATE do not update ports in ${MAKE} update
16 #       -DNO_ROOT install without using root privilege
17 #       -DNO_DOCUPDATE do not update doc in ${MAKE} update
18 #       -DWITHOUT_CTF do not run the DTrace CTF conversion tools on built objects
19 #       LOCAL_DIRS="list of dirs" to add additional dirs to the SUBDIR list
20 #       LOCAL_ITOOLS="list of tools" to add additional tools to the ITOOLS list
21 #       LOCAL_LIB_DIRS="list of dirs" to add additional dirs to libraries target
22 #       LOCAL_MTREE="list of mtree files" to process to allow local directories
23 #           to be created before files are installed
24 #       LOCAL_TOOL_DIRS="list of dirs" to add additional dirs to the build-tools
25 #           list
26 #       METALOG="path to metadata log" to write permission and ownership
27 #           when NO_ROOT is set.  (default: ${DESTDIR}/METALOG)
28 #       TARGET="machine" to crossbuild world for a different machine type
29 #       TARGET_ARCH= may be required when a TARGET supports multiple endians
30 #       BUILDENV_SHELL= shell to launch for the buildenv target (def:/bin/sh)
31 #       WORLD_FLAGS= additional flags to pass to make(1) during buildworld
32 #       KERNEL_FLAGS= additional flags to pass to make(1) during buildkernel

206 #
207 # Building a world goes through the following stages
208 #
209 # 1. legacy stage [BMAKE]
210 #       This stage is responsible for creating compatibility
211 #       shims that are needed by the bootstrap-tools,
212 #       build-tools and cross-tools stages.
213 # 1. bootstrap-tools stage [BMAKE]
214 #       This stage is responsible for creating programs that
215 #       are needed for backward compatibility reasons. They
216 #       are not built as cross-tools.
217 # 2. build-tools stage [TMAKE]
218 #       This stage is responsible for creating the object
219 #       tree and building any tools that are needed during
220 #       the build process.
221 # 3. cross-tools stage [XMAKE]
222 #       This stage is responsible for creating any tools that
223 #       are needed for cross-builds. A cross-compiler is one
224 #       of them.
225 # 4. world stage [WMAKE]
226 #       This stage actually builds the world.
227 # 5. install stage (optional) [IMAKE]
228 #       This stage installs a previously built world.
229 #
